redis提供了对值进行运算的命令 redis对象包含哪几种

【redis提供了对值进行运算的命令 redis对象包含哪几种】导读:Redis是一种基于内存的数据结构存储系统 , 它支持多种类型的数据对象 。本文将介绍Redis中包含哪几种对象,并对每种对象进行详细解析 。
1. 字符串对象(String Object)
字符串对象是Redis中最基本的数据类型,也是最常用的数据类型之一 。字符串对象可以存储任何类型的数据 , 包括二进制数据 。在Redis中,字符串对象还有许多特殊的用途 , 例如作为计数器、锁、分布式锁等 。
2. 列表对象(List Object)
列表对象是一个按照插入顺序排序的字符串对象集合 。列表对象可以用来实现队列或栈等数据结构,也可以用来存储日志数据等 。
3. 哈希对象(Hash Object)
哈希对象是一种键值对集合,其中每个键都对应着一个值 。哈希对象通常用来存储对象的属性信息,例如用户信息、文章信息等 。
4. 集合对象(Set Object)
集合对象是一组无序的字符串对象集合 , 其中每个字符串对象都是唯一的 。集合对象可以用来实现社交网络中的好友关系、推荐算法等 。
5. 有序集合对象(Sorted Set Object)
有序集合对象是一组有序的字符串对象集合,其中每个字符串对象都有一个分值 。有序集合对象通常用来存储排行榜、评分系统等 。
总结:Redis支持多种类型的数据对象,包括字符串对象、列表对象、哈希对象、集合对象和有序集合对象 。每种对象都有其特殊的用途和优势,可以根据实际需求选择使用 。掌握这些对象的特点和使用方法,能够更好地利用Redis来解决实际问题 。

    推荐阅读